Output 669e4e0a786f4baf8de88d3ef6f079ab52573b04a83aa72676eb8e748019b1dc:1

value
150000
script pubkey
OP_0 OP_PUSHBYTES_20 d68d7cb07ba3df6057648eae5abd4ae7f4cc4cb6
address
bc1q66xhevrm500kq4my36h94022ul6vcn9kj86m8k
transaction
669e4e0a786f4baf8de88d3ef6f079ab52573b04a83aa72676eb8e748019b1dc